The wolf I share my body with was born able to separate herself from me and wander around in a spirit form, but now that we managed to get ourselves permanently separated, she's trapped as spirit and I'm dying.
I've been searching for some kind of magical fix-all that could bring us back together, but so far, the only answer I've found is the one thing I can never accept:
Taking a mate.
My friends are interviewing guys, trying to find the best candidate for something I swore I'd never do.
The only man I somewhat trust has started leaving notes everywhere with reasons as to why he's the best candidate.
And my wolf is just as on board with hiring a mate as the rest of them.
I want to survive more than almost anything, but that almost includes my only option.
I've got three months to decide whether or not to take a mate… or my body will become spirit, like my wolf's.
*This new-adult novel is a full-length, slow-burn standalone romance featuring a sexy werewolf cowboy, far too many mate-interviews, a heap of corny love notes, and a woman who keeps her distance from *most* men.

4.5 stars. Lex (Alexandra), the female lead, has had her wolf separate from her and travel with her in spirit form. When her future seeing grandmother tells her she has three months to live unless she mates, she makes a list of activities to complete and sets out. She takes her best friend, Parker, the male lead, for company, fully expecting to die by the end of it because she can’t stand to be touched after past sexual abuse. But Parker gently and patiently persists in suggesting he’s a real alternative and Lex decides she does want to live AND she loves him enough to try with him.
And then his family implodes and his ex-fated-mate who abused him demands him back…
This story is female lead POV only - that’s honestly the main reason I didn’t give it 5 stars; I really prefer dual POV. The story is well written and deeply moving. There are HEAPS of trigger topics handled by both main and secondary characters but I feel it is sensitively done and really shows how messy life is but how good it can still be.
